Pawsey Internships: Call for Students

The Call for Pawsey Intern Applications for 2025/2026 is now OPEN!!!

Are you ready to take on an exciting challenge and enhance your skills in computational science and research? Are you eager to gain hands-on experience in cutting-edge research projects? Here’s your chance to join the 2025/2026 Pawsey Summer Internship Program!!!

We are looking for exceptional students ready to give their best to this 10-week, paid Program. Specifically, we are looking for:

  • 2nd and 3rd year, and Honours students
  • Master’s by research and PhD students

An indicative list of projects and requirements can be found using this CSIRO application page, where you will also find a link to apply.

📢 About the Program

  • The internship program is conducted remotely, with the possibility for some interns to work on-site depending on the project.
  • The Program offers students a paid internship focused on building skills and experience in computational science and research projects.
  • During the Program, interns collaborate with national and/or international supervisors and collaborators.
  • Interns will receive guidance from Pawsey staff on best practices for using Pawsey resources, creating and presenting videos and posters, and techniques for scientific communication.
  • The Internship program includes induction and training sessions covering topics such as supercomputing, data management, and scientific visualization.
  • Interns will be supported by Intern Mentors and will have the opportunity to form a Community of Practice with fellow interns.

📢 Duration & Pay

The paid Internship Program lasts for 10 weeks, over the course of 12 weeks (24th November 2025- 13th February 2026).  There is a 2-week shutdown at the end of the year.

📢 Pawsey’s Expectations

As a condition of award, Pawsey Interns are expected to:

  • Be available for the entire duration of the Internship Program (Working full-time Monday to Friday)
  • Attend the training series throughout the internship (This will be remote and/or in-person. If in-person Pawsey will fund your travel and accommodation).
  • Make satisfactory progress across the internship period, submitting short weekly updates.
  • Submit a project poster, short report, and video at the end of the internship.
  • Participate fully each day, and in the Pawsey Friday event (13 February 2026)
  • Answer fellow interns’ posted questions as/when possible, creating a collegial Internship atmosphere.

📢 Requirements

  • Applicants MUST be currently enrolled in an Australian university, either in an undergraduate program, a Master’s by research program, or a PhD program.
  • If you are a PhD candidate, you MUST ensure that you are eligible to apply for a paid internship and are available FULL TIME to complete the internship.
  • Successful applicants will be required to complete a National Police Check (NPC).
  • Vacation students must be Australian citizens or Permanent Residents OR must have an appropriate visa issued by the Department of Immigration. You must be attending an Australian University.
  • Only students who have NOT participated previously in a Pawsey Summer Internship Program are eligible to apply, UNLESS you are applying for the Intern Mentor positions.

📢 Key Dates

  • July– Call for Student Applications Open
  • August – Call for student Application Closes
  • September – Shortlisted Interns Notified
  • September/October – CSIRO Recruitment and Administration
  • 24 November 2025 – Internship Starts
  • 13 February 2026 – Internship Finishes (Reports & Videos due 2 weeks after completion)

The Application

Applicants will rank their preferred project choices. While we make every effort to match a student with a top preference, sometimes students may be invited to participate on a different project. An indicative listing of projects can be accessed from the application page. This list is not exhaustive. 

Applicants will be assessed on several criteria, including the matching of their skills to specific project skills & location requirements (if any).
